Vocational Programs at Avalon Institute-Aurora
Avalon Institute-Aurora (referred to as Avalon Institute-Aurora) is a Private, Less than 2 years school located in Aurora, CO. It is a non-degree granting school. The 2023 tuition & fees at Avalon Institute-Aurora is $9,000. The school has a total enrollment of 188 and the students to faculty ratio is 4.76% (21 to 1). Avalon Institute-Aurora supports distance learning and you may earn a degree/certificate through online education.

Largest Programs Tuition and Completion Time
The largest program at Avalon Institute-Aurora is Aesthetician/Esthetician and Skin Care Specialist. Its 2023 tuition & fees is $9,000 and average completion time is 5 months. The next table shows the largest program information at Avalon Institute-Aurora.
Program Name | Tuition & Fees | Books & Supplies Costs | Program Length | Average Completion Time |
---|---|---|---|---|
Aesthetician/Esthetician and Skin Care Specialist | $9,000 | $2,002 | 600 credit hours | 5 months |
Cosmetology/Cosmetologist | $17,250 | $2,218 | 1,500 credit hours | 12 months |
Barbering/Barber | $17,250 | $2,218 | 1,500 credit hours | 12 months |
Average Costs of Attendance (COA)
The 2023 average costs of attendance (COA) is $22,458 when a student lives off-campus. It includes tuition & fees, costs of books & supplies, room & boards, and other living expenses. The financial aid amount is $3,243 and, after receiving the aid, the net price is $19,215. Next table shows each cost item at Avalon Institute-Aurora.
Amounts | |
---|---|
Tuition & Fees | $9,000 |
Books & Supplies | $2,002 |
Off-campus Living Costs | $11,456 |
Average Financial Aid | $3,243 |
COA | $22,458 (off-campus) |
After Financial Aid | $19,215 (off-campus) |

Student Population
At Avalon Institute-Aurora, there are total 188 students. By gender, there are 4 men and 184 women students at Avalon Institute-Aurora. The next table summarizes the student population at Avalon Institute-Aurora.
Total | Male | Female | |
---|---|---|---|
Total | 188 | 4 | 184 |
American Indian/Native American | 2 | 0 | 2 |
Asian | 4 | 0 | 4 |
Black/African American | 36 | 0 | 36 |
Hispanic | 81 | 0 | 81 |
Native Hawaiian or Other Pacific Islander | 0 | 0 | 0 |
White | 44 | 3 | 41 |
Two More | 15 | 1 | 14 |
Un-Known | 6 | 0 | 6 |
